Comparison review

Galaxy Fold is much better than Motorola Moto G8 Plus, having a 97.6 score against 77.6. Even though the Galaxy Fold and the Motorola Moto G8 Plus were released with only 1 months difference, the Galaxy Fold design is much thinner but heavier. The Motorola Moto G8 Plus and the Galaxy Fold feature very similar screens, because although the Galaxy Fold has a just a bit worse display pixel density, it also counts with a quite better 1536 x 2152px resolution and a bigger screen.

Samsung Galaxy Fold has a superior storage to install applications and games than Moto G8 Plus, because although it has no slot for SD memory cards, it also counts with more internal memory. The Galaxy Fold features a bit more powerful processing unit than Motorola Moto G8 Plus,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Galaxy Fold also has a higher amount of RAM memory.

Galaxy Fold has a bit longer battery lifetime than Moto G8 Plus, because it has a 10% more battery size. Motorola Moto G8 Plus captures much clearer pictures and videos than Samsung Galaxy Fold, because although it has a smaller diafragm aperture which is not nice for low light photography and videos and slower 30 fps video frame rates, and they both have the same 3840x2160 (4K) video resolution, the Motorola Moto G8 Plus also counts with a lot more megapixels camera in the back and a lot bigger camera sensor which provides a way higher image and video quality.
